Nearly 50% of Sellers’ Agents Said Staging a Home Reduced Its Time on Market, NAR Report Finds

House Staging

Key Highlights Almost half of sellers’ agents (48%) reported that home staging decreased a property’s time on the market. Twenty percent of both buyers’ and sellers’ agents said home staging increased the dollar value offered by between 1% and 5% compared to similar homes on the market not staged. Staging
